So I just finished Daredevil: The Man without Fear by Frank Miller and John Romita Jr. Both artists work really well together and Miller is still on his A-Game before he went completely nuts.
You can really tell that the Netflix show took alot of inspiration from this book without completely copying it so they are alot of surprises if you have seen the show. Its a great origin for the character that dives into who the character is an what makes him tick. |
